手写的约束的几种方式

  1. Using NSLayoutConstraint initializer
  2. Using Visual Format Language
  3. Using UIView.AutoresizingMask
  4. Using NSLayoutAnchor
  5. intrinsicContentSize and NSLayoutAnchor
Read more »

aqua design 最喜欢的 mac 风格
Skeuomorph ui,ios6 及之前的拟物
neumorphism,一种带点阴影的扁平风格
glassmorphism 玻璃透明风格的扁平

aqua design 2024

Read more »

记得还在公司的时候,实现了一个课表和sticker section header的 UICollectionView,现在回想起来,一片虚无哈,因为没有整理和总结。所有的整理都要补上啦。

当然,UICollectionView 最厉害的武器就是自己实现一个 UICollectionViewLayout,相当强大。

Read more »

魔方(Rubik’s Cube),刚毕业的时候第一家单位,第一次遇到一个玩魔方的小伙伴,那时候算是初次接触,不过随着后续他的离开就断掉了。
不知道什么时候媳妇在哪里凑单搞了个二阶魔方,心血来潮想玩下,本来想着会简单很多,估计也是的,但是也找了不少地方,就一个 youtube 上的介绍很到位 【鸟杰魔方】二阶魔方基础教程,一条公式还原二阶,二阶看这个就够了。

万万没想到的是,想让媳妇把魔方拆了然后按照颜色装好,以免出现窜色的情况,但是晚上直接掰断了一角,只能等新的来了。

Read more »

早年因为没有记录的习惯,导致实现过一个自动生成 markdown link 的 popclip 插件找不到了,其中就用的 AppleScript 来实现的。
那就从新出发。

Mac OS 上打开 Automater.app 然后新建"快捷操作"→"资源库下的实用工具"→"运行AppleScript",就可以填入 AppleScript 脚本进行测试了。
然后测试好的脚本可以放在 popclip 也可以放在 alfred 里做成任务。

Read more »

用了 tabbarcontroller 嵌套 navigationcontroller 的 iOS 应用直接成 Mac 应用的话,风格还是 iOS 的,其中tabbar的两种 Mac 形式是:

  • Title Bar
  • Sider Bar
Read more »

iOS 13 之后系统内容了些 icon 和 color,尤其是适配 dark mode 时候会很方便。
本来想用 mirror 直接得到 uicolor 的 system color 展示,貌似不能成功,返回 children 是 0,看了其他人都是列举出所有 property 来展示的。

参考

Read more »

今天浏览控件,发现了这个曾经用过的控件,短小精干,决定迁移到 Swift 上来。
如果不能为曾经的爱做一点什么话,那还能做什么事情呢哈哈。

参考

Read more »

最近时不时看到,点击 MacOS Big Sur 上的 App 图标,图标只会在 Docker 上一直跳动,并没有打开的意思。
一看连着 VPN,然后就想到了 OCSP,有点流氓的东西,相对于苹果,用户真的就是鱼肉,或不单单是苹果,任何成为巨无霸的东西,都会变质,没有例外。

参考

Read more »

就在刚刚,iMac 风扇疯狂作响,一看 launchd 进程每秒 30+M 的数据写入量,持续写入,厉害了。
2021-04-01
ps. 可能误会磁盘的问题了,原来是 source tree 的问题,请往下看。

launchd

Read more »
0%